E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
——declspec
调用DLL找不到函数名或者函数乱码问题
本博客来自:点击打开链接最近简单研究了一下dll的导出函数,整理了一下1.导出函数名的问题dll导出函数最简单的语法是void__
declspec
(dllexport)fun();由于它默认的是c++的调用约定
忘世麒麟
·
2020-06-22 16:18
C++
链接库
DLL
DLL
c++ 打包dll 给unity调用
一.vs版本2017新建项目二.C++的实例代码#pragmaonce#ifdefined(EXPORTBUILD)#define_DLLExport__
declspec
(dllexport)#else
深林_
·
2020-06-22 11:15
c++学习总结
Unity学习总结
调用C语言编写的DLL文件
源文件中的内容如下:__
declspec
(dllexport)intmax(intx,inty)/*比较两个整型变量大小的函数max*/{if(x>y)returnx;elsereturny;
a572893208
·
2020-06-22 11:44
C++调用dll文件的两种方法
DLL中导出函数的声明有两种方式:一种是在函数声明中加上_
declspec
(dllexport)关键字,另一种方式就是采用模块定义文件声明。.
游戏鸟
·
2020-06-22 10:09
C++
将C语言源代码编译成动态链接库
一、源代码我们创建一个C语言源程序:Test.c关键:__
declspec
(dllexport)申明将这个方法导出到DLL中。
YapingXin
·
2020-06-22 08:22
C
关于C#调用C++时候传出参数有char**该如何处理
场景:有一个C++的dll中一个非托管C++原型如下extern"C"_
declspec
(dllexport)voidGetResult(char*a,char**pBuf){sprintf((pBuf
Sayesan
·
2020-06-22 04:53
(二)VS 2019 使用setdll调试 远程注入的DLL
,否则会出现UnstallDall.dlldoesnotexportfunctionwithordinal#1代码只需要放在dllmain.cpp中即可://在使用Debug远程调试DLL必须要有__
declspec
Garc
·
2020-06-22 03:29
C++
C#调用C++的DLL 所有数据类型转换方式
/C++中的DLL函数原型为//extern"C"__
declspec
(dllexport)bool方法名一(constchar*变量名1,unsignedchar*变量名2)//extern"C"__
Miss_Easy
·
2020-06-22 01:25
C#
C++
dll
c++调用c语言写的dll
C语言部分头文件如下#pragmaonce//这里是为了c++调用避免出现链接错误#ifdef__cplusplusextern"C"{#endif//__cplusplus__
declspec
(dllimport
墨黑白灰
·
2020-06-22 01:16
c++
OpenCV中的CV_EXPORT是什么意思
首先,我们跟踪代码,看看,CV_EXPORTS具体是什么:也就是说,CV_EXPORTS实际上就是__
declspec
(dllexport),查阅google可以发现,其作用如下:使用__
declspec
LinJM-机器视觉
·
2020-06-22 00:02
OpenCV学习笔记
C#调用C++非托管代码
#ifdefSUPERDLLS_EXPORTS#defineSUPERDLLS_API__
declspec
(dllexport)#else#defineSUPERDLLS_API__
declspec
(dllimport
Sun.ME
·
2020-06-21 23:50
C++
C#
C# 调用 dll 文件
//#include"stdafx.h"extern"C"__
declspec
(dllexport)intTheAdd(inta,intb){returna+b;}
Xu小亿
·
2020-06-21 22:57
C#
c++编写dll给unity使用的禁忌,小记
正常写法:.h文件#ifdefDLL1_EXPORTS#defineNDDATASDK_APIextern"C"_
declspec
(dllexport)#else#defineNDDATASDK_APIextern"C
worthgod
·
2020-06-21 20:23
c#
unity
c++
Unity调用C++动态链接库(DLL)或者C#类库
一、Unity调用C++动态链接库1.新建DLL2.新建头文件及源文件CPP(头文件U3DTest.h)#ifdefined(EXPORTBUILD)#define_DLLExport__
declspec
Exclaiming
·
2020-06-21 20:40
unity
C语言使用VS2017来封装动态库并使用动态库流程!
这里封装一个简单数组排序功能做例子)头文件:#pragmaonce#ifdefSORT_ARR//通过对宏定义的判断来使得头文件具有导出使调用导出函数,导入时调用导入函数#else#defineSORT_ARR__
declspec
Mongo兵长
·
2020-06-21 19:54
学习时光
DLL 中 .def文件的使用
DLL中导出函数的声明有两种方式:一种为在函数声明中加上__
declspec
(dllexport),这里不再举例说明;另外一种方式是采用模块定义(.def)文件声明,.def文件为链接器提供了有关被链接程序的导出
Cpp_funs
·
2020-06-21 18:39
在C#中调用C语言标准动态库方法
软件深入详解使用教程(3)详解网络嗅探工具的原理|Sniffer|Wireshark→在C#中调用C语言标准动态库方法2010年07月19日SethC#&.Net编程Gotocomment1.打造标准动态库__
declspec
iot007
·
2020-06-21 15:40
C# 调用C/C++ Dll(参数含char*指针,返回char*指针)
动态库://MyPointDll.hextern"C"_
declspec
(dllexport)char*strcpyTest(char*dest,char*sour);//MyPointDll.cpp:
youqingyike
·
2020-06-21 15:30
C#
C#调用C++ 生成动态链接库dll(最详细的整理)
__
declspec
(dllexport)声明一个导出函数,一般用于dll中__
declspec
(dllimport)声明一个导入函数,一般用于使用某个dll的exe中使用C#调用C++DLL,一直都不能引用
xxty1122
·
2020-06-21 14:19
C#学习
在C#中使用C/C++写的DLL,以及数据转换大全
想想看,很自然就联想到了DLL动态连接库把C/C++的代码编译成DLL,然后使用,这里我假设我的C/C++代码里包含一个函数,叫average(intav[])申明如下:extern"C"__
declspec
任薛纪
·
2020-06-21 14:00
C#学习
C++学习
C语言封装dll
然后在stdafx.h头文件中声明导出函数,举例如下__
declspec
(dllexport)intadd(inta,intb);//add是函数名,可声明多个__
declspec
(dllexport)
天已青色等烟雨来
·
2020-06-21 14:41
C
Visual Studio 2019 使用C语言创建动态链接库(Dll)并使用C语言和C#实现调用
建立动态链接库项目2、创建头文件和源文件删除framework.h、dllmain.c等现有文件(照顾VS2013等低版本),创建新的头文件Mydll.cMydll.hMydll.h头文件代码如下:#include_
declspec
smile_2020
·
2020-06-21 12:09
C语言
VS2019
dll
动态链接库
C#调用c++的动态库dll演示例程
1.首先编写c++动态库extern"C"__
declspec
(dllexport)int__stdcalladd(intx,inty){returnx+y;}extern"C"__
declspec
(dllexport
weixin_34378767
·
2020-06-21 11:13
C/C++ 调用DLL
2019独角兽企业重金招聘Python工程师标准>>>//dllExport.c__
declspec
(dllexport)intAdd(inta,intb){returna+b;}//VisualStudio2015
weixin_34245749
·
2020-06-21 11:26
C#调用C/C++ DLL 参数传递和回调函数的总结
原文:C#调用C/C++DLL参数传递和回调函数的总结Int型传入:Dll端:extern"C"__
declspec
(dllexport)intAdd(inta,intb){returna+b;}C#端
weixin_34191845
·
2020-06-21 11:15
c# 调用 c dll 例子
1//case1传递int*/////////////////////////////////////////////2extern“C”__
declspec
(dllexport)intmySum(int
weixin_34061482
·
2020-06-21 11:22
在C#中调用VC编写的dll库
也可以使用新的文件添加代码;extern“C“__
declspec
(dllexport)intAdd(inta,
weixin_30767921
·
2020-06-21 10:49
VS2012 C# 调用 C dll
建一个解决方案,包含3个工程:WIN32DLL、控制台应用(c)、控制台应用(c#)WIN32DLL代码:#ifdef__cpluscplus#defineEXPORTextern"C"__
declspec
weixin_30551963
·
2020-06-21 10:55
C语言创建动态dll,并调用该dll(visual studio 2013环境下)
3、点击源文件,创建一个main.c文件4、在main.c中写入一个简单的函数,内容如下:__
declspec
(dllexport)intmymax(inta,intb){returna+b;}5、编译生成
天南韩立
·
2020-06-21 09:53
C/C++
Microsoft
Visual
Studio
C#调用C代码DLL
首先我们新建一个C语言的WIN32项目选择项目类型为DLL库在新建的项目中我们添加Ccode.h,Ccode.cpp两个文件Code.hextern"C"__
declspec
(dllexport)intMinus
@David Liu
·
2020-06-21 08:56
c#开发
C语言
C#调用C/C++写的dll
C++代码:头文件:extern"C"_
declspec
(dllexport)boolopenWindow(char*classname,char*name);或EXTERN_C_
declspec
(dllexport
李子果
·
2020-06-21 08:05
VS2010产生C的dll方法和C#调用方式
1234567//CDLL.h头文件#ifndefLIB_H#defineLIB_Hextern"C"_
declspec
(dllexport)intadd(intx,inty);//声明为C编译、链接方式的外部函数
u010655348
·
2020-06-21 08:00
正则表达式不匹配特定格式的一种方式和sed的多表达式应用
函数需要增加如下声明__
declspec
(dllexport)voidfunc(void*arg)/*__
declspec
(dllexport)在后续我直接宏定义为了类似WIN_DECLARE的格式*/
darkpush
·
2020-06-21 08:28
linux系统运维
关于C#调用C++时候传出参数有char**该如何处理
场景:有一个C++的dll中一个非托管C++原型如下extern"C"_
declspec
(dllexport)voidGetResult(char*a,char**pBuf){sprintf((pBuf
完美世界ssrs
·
2020-06-21 07:45
C#
C/C++
C# 调用dll 封送结构体 结构体数组
一.结构体的传递cpp代码#defineJNAAPIextern"C"__
declspec
(dllexport)//C方式导出函数typedefstruct{intosVersion;intmajorVersion
snakorse
·
2020-06-21 07:59
C#基础
易语言
C#引用C++ Dll 所有类型转换方式
//C++中的DLL函數原型為//extern"C"__
declspec
(dllexport)bool方法名一(constchar*變量名1,unsignedchar*變量名2)//extern"C"_
sanzhong104204
·
2020-06-21 07:46
软件与WEB
C#调用C++的dll文件
新建项目VS新建-->项目-->模板-->VisualC++-->Win32控制台应用程序下一步-->dll、空项目-->完成1.2新建cpp头文件:cal.h#pragmaonceextern"C"_
declspec
王雪亮114
·
2020-06-21 05:52
asp.net
Unity3D(C#)和c++ dll交互问题
msdn.microsoft.com/en-us/library/ms235281.aspx首先假如我们有TestC.dll(ios下是.a,Android下是.so),该dll由c++编写,并导出了__
declspec
nature19862001
·
2020-06-21 03:02
VS2010中C#调用C函数
extern"C"__
declspec
(dllexport)v
moshou0
·
2020-06-21 03:10
C#代码
C#调用C/C++动态库的参数传递---数组指针的传递
C/C++CODE:extern"C"__
declspec
(dllexport)voidTest(int*ptr_int,unsignedchar*ptr_byte);...extern"C"__
declspec
lht02032003
·
2020-06-21 02:00
C/C++交互
C#
在VS2008环境下编写C语言DLL,并在C++和C#项目下调用
b)编写头文件(edrlib.h):#ifdef__cplusplus#defineEXPORTextern"C"__
declspec
(dllexport)#else#defineEXPORT__
declspec
le_zhou
·
2020-06-21 02:37
C
c#调用C++的DLL找不到入口点
C++源码如下:—————————————————a.h—————————————————#ifdefA_EXPORTS#defineA_API__
declspec
(dllexport)#else#defineA_API
iteye_16389
·
2020-06-21 02:38
其他技术
C#调用C++的DLL搜集整理的所有数据类型转换方式
//C++中的DLL函数原型为//extern"C"__
declspec
(dllexport)bool方法名一(constchar*变量名1,unsign
iteye_1503
·
2020-06-21 02:04
c语言创建dll,c语言调用dll
1.创建头文件cdll.h#ifndef_DLLMAIN_H#define_DLLMAIN_H#ifndefDLL_EXPORT#define_LIBAPI__
declspec
(dllexport)#else
befreedomjustice
·
2020-06-21 00:40
c
VS2017——C语言dll编译并调用
1.生成dll1.1文件——新建——项目,选择如下图1.2新建头文件test.h和源文件test.c//test.h__
declspec
(dllexport)intsum(inta,intb);//test.c
baijian1989
·
2020-06-20 23:55
C语言
C#调用外部C++生成DLL
外部调用函数声明#pragmaonce#ifndefKINECTDATAGENERATOR_H#defineKINECTDATAGENERATOR_H//initializeKinectextern"C"_
declspec
arhaiyun
·
2020-06-20 23:26
C语言生成调用DLL
dll.h,和一个源文件,dll.c头文件dll.h内容:#ifndef_DLL_DEMO_H_#define_DLL_DEMO_H_#ifdefDLLDEMO_EXPORTS#defineDLL_DEMO_
declspec
射下北极星
·
2020-06-20 22:51
沉思厅
使用VS2012生成和调用DLL文件
有关dll的详细说明,参考资料:DLL的编写,导出函数如何编写Dll组件编程com组件和一般dll的区别COM与DLL的区别__
declspec
(dllexport)首先明确,不要幻想通过VC写的dll
Kelvin_Ngan
·
2020-06-20 22:34
C/C++
VS2012 C语言dll文件生成和C#调用
1.在需要调用的函数前面添加__
declspec
(dllexport)。
sdu程序猿
·
2020-06-20 21:33
c语言进阶
C语言生成DLL供C#调用
编写C程序如下:#include"stdio.h"__
declspec
(dllexport)voidMyFun(){printf("thisisadll\n");}保存,取名为My.C运行VS命令提示,
njyzf
·
2020-06-20 20:36
C/C++
上一页
11
12
13
14
15
16
17
18
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他